Course Content

• Introduction to Food Safety Management Systems (FSMS) and Auditing Principles
• Food Safety Hazards, Risks, and Critical Control Points (HACCP)
• Legal and Regulatory Frameworks for Food Safety Compliance (Legislation, Standards)
• Food Safety Compliance Auditing Techniques and Methodologies (Internal Audits, External Audits)
• Documentation Review and Verification in Food Safety Audits
• Corrective Actions and Preventive Actions (CAPA) in Food Safety
• Effective Communication and Report Writing for Food Safety Audits
• Global Food Safety Standards (e.g., ISO 22000, BRC, IFS)
• Food Safety Auditing Case Studies and Best Practices

Career path

Career Role Description
Food Safety Auditor Conducting food safety audits, ensuring compliance with regulations (HACCP, BRC). High demand in the UK food industry.
Food Safety Compliance Manager Overseeing all aspects of food safety compliance; developing and implementing programs. Requires strong auditing and reporting skills.
Quality Assurance Specialist (Food Safety) Ensuring quality and safety standards throughout the food production process. Involves auditing, reporting and continuous improvement.
Food Safety Consultant Providing expert advice on food safety legislation and best practices to food businesses. Requires extensive auditing and reporting experience.
